PUNJAB AND HARAYANA HIGH COURT

Year of decision: 2024
Details

Criminal Procedure Code, 1973, Section 438 -- Anticipatory bail - Non-recovery of dowry articles cannot be made a ground to deny concession of bail to petitioner...........

PUNJAB AND HARAYANA HIGH COURT

Year of decision: 2024
Details

Criminal Procedure Code, 1973, Section 438, Indian Penal Code, 1860, Section 406, 498A -- Anticipatory bail - Offence u/ss 406, 498-A IPC - Non-recovery of dowry articles/Istridhan, cannot ordinarily be a ground, by itself, for declining a plea for grant of anticipatory bail to the husband or his relatives...........
